โฆ Synopsis
In this paper, Helmholtz's free streamline theory is used to determine the contraction coefficients of two jets formed by a finite, two-dimensional stream impinging obliquely upon a plane lamina placed between two infinite parallel planes.
The agreement between the results obtained from experiments and those calculated from theory is excellent.
Thus, the theory is expected to be useful as a design tool for such boundary configurations as those represented by butterfly valves.
